Russian miner and steelmaker NLMK has begun installing a briquetting plant at its flagship Novolipetsk Iron and Steel Works in west Russia, which will utilize blast furnace waste to reduce input costs. Once commissioned, by the end of 2018, the plant will produce up to 700,000 mt/year of briquettes made from iron ore concentrate mixed with blast furnace sludge and other BF waste, including dust.
